Basic features missing: autorun, 3rd person view, free camera move
Autorun is not implemented - this is a major issue, getting tired of pressing the 'W' key all the time.
3rd person view somehow works in the debug mode, but the aiming is not OK, and the animation is not the best.
Free camera is assigned to L-Alt key, but doesn't work. Can't look behind/around.

Why would you want free-camera? There's no 3rd-person POV so there's no reason to not tie the camera to your facing.

Even *with* a 3rd-person POV I find having a where the camera looks being different from the character's facing really annoying - its one of the hallmarks of a game developed by people steeped in console game development culture (twin-stick gamepad) and not PC development culture (M/KB).

Right now you can look around simply by moving the mouse (mouselook) which has the added advantage that if there's something ravenous right behind you, you are already facing it and can react faster.
